Well, these stories inspire creativity in multiple ways. Firstly, they break the boundaries of our normal perception of time. We can create unique characters who have to adapt to different time settings. For instance, a character from the present going to the Victorian era has to learn new social norms. Secondly, time travel stories can play with cause and effect. Writers can explore how a small change in the past can have a huge impact on the present or future. This concept can be applied in various creative fields like filmmaking, where directors can use it to create mind - blowing plot twists. Thirdly, the settings of different time periods offer a rich palette for creativity. We can describe the vivid landscapes, cultures, and technologies of different eras, which can inspire painters, designers, and storytellers alike.
